9d81ba77b7 w6c+wwstage: array global-aggregate-receive g = f() (#272 commit-2)
The caller-half of the global case: `g = mk()` into a GLOBAL array
stored only the first word — a ≤24B reg-return landed `MOVQ AX, g(SB)`
(8 of 24 bytes); a >24B sret-return hit the #220 sret-to-symbol gate
which was TY_STRUCT-only and fell through to the same truncation.

≤24B: the local aggregate-receive arm was `off != 0`-only, so a global
array fell to the scalar IDENT store. Add a global ARRAY arm — LEAQ
name(SB), DI then store the full+tail words from AX/DX/CX (an array is
never float-class, so AX/DX/CX is always the transport; no `g+8(SB)`
operand form exists). Mirrors the str/slice global arm.
>24B: add TY_ARRAY to the #220 sret-to-symbol gate (cg_sret_dest_sym /
sretdestnode) — the callee writes the whole array through RDI.

A ≤24B STRUCT global receive can be float-class (X0/X1, not AX/DX/CX),
so it is left at its pre-existing symmetric behaviour — no consumer.

949_aggret_source_run gains global_recv (c → 15) and global_recv_sret
(>24B → 22), both with per-row byte-id.

0d39129741 w6c+wwstage: aggregate return from any addressable source (#272 commit-1)
The N_RETURN aggregate arms gated the return source on N_IDENT ||
N_STRUCTLIT; every other aggregate rvalue (array literal, o.field N_DOT,
a[i] N_INDEX, *p deref) fell through to the scalar-AX default = a silent
8-byte truncation. Both stages emitted byte-IDENTICAL wrong asm, so the
byte-id gate could not catch it (#263 class) — the fix converges on the
runtime oracle.

Mirror the arg-side closure #271 landed: both arms (≤24B @retscr and
>24B sret) now funnel N_ARRLIT through the literal element fill and
N_DOT/N_INDEX/deref through aggarg_srcaddr + the #265/#268 whole-
aggregate copy. Type-agnostic, so struct AND array returns are closed.
A close-by-construction loud-stop (rule 7) guards any future unhandled
aggregate source from reaching the scalar default.

Closes the callee-half of (b)/(c) and the addressable siblings. The
g = mk() global-receive caller-half is commit-2.

949_aggret_source_run pins the class: array-literal / N_DOT / N_INDEX /
deref / named-ident control / >24B-sret-deref / struct-field / struct-
deref, each summing all members (full readback) with per-row byte-id.
